The Seneca County Sheriff’s Office says deputies and firefighters responded to a vehicle fire in the Village of Interlaken Friday morning.
Deputies were called to a local business around 8:20 a.m. for reports of a fully engulfed vehicle. Responding fire crews found a 1982 Chevy RV on fire in a parking area on the south side of the business.
The RV was heavily damaged and declared a total loss. The business and the nearby Interlaken Library both sustained minor cosmetic damage, but no injuries were reported. The total cost of damages has not yet been determined. The li brary is closed for today
The Sheriff’s Office was assisted by the Interlaken, Ovid, and Trumansburg fire departments, the Seneca County Fire Investigation Team, and Interlaken Police.
